I am no stranger to HP. Owning several Grand Nationals ,Turbo Trans am's and sick Z28's you learn to respect power.
To answer some of your questions: First of all, the bike was professionally built by Black Swamp Choppers.It isnt a rocket until 10k RPM's and up (thats when the secondary injectors start firing). I have not been in the trails with it yet because I am going to tune it properly for this type of riding with a Power commander and LM1. It is a stock 04 motor with custom headers,custom intake,K&N filter and titanium R1 cans. This is kind of a warrior chassis(title is still warrior). A lot of the structural tubing is replaced with chrome molly and fabricated around the motor. The rear +4 swingarm is custom fabbed (chrome molly ladder bar setup) to withstand the massive amount of torque. All the structural tubing holding the motor in is all Chrome molly professionally TIG welded. I am a fabricator of 13yrs and know my craftsmanship..There is no expense spared on this ride. Rydur is a veteran at fabricating parts and he was amazed at the detail given. It also has been scaled 51/49 no rider.
